> binman: nxp_imx8mcst: Handle FCFB header during SPI NOR boot
>
> In case the image that is wrapped in the nxp_imx8mcst already contains
> an FCFB header which is mandatory for SPI NOR boot, then the IVT is at
> offset 0x1000 instead of offset 0x0, but the whole image including the
> FCFB header must be signed to prevent attacker from tampering with any
> of the headers. Add the FCFB handling.
